    Do remember, dear reader, that there are a lot of lonely people out there. people who, like me, may only have one or two conversations a week, some less than that.  Yes, social distancing is important, but you would be surprised what a sunny hello from 2 meters away or over the garden wall can do , a five minute chat can lift someone’s day , brighten outlook , you might make a friend , you may even save a life. We might all be in masks right now , but we are still smiling people behind them."
